THERAPEUTIC INDICATIONS:

Glipizide is used with a proper diet and exercise program to control high blood sugar in people with type 2 diabetes. It may also be used with other diabetes medications. Controlling high blood sugar helps prevent kidney damage, blindness, nerve problems, loss of limbs, and sexual function problems.

Introduction to Glipizide Tablet 10mg

Glipizide Tablet 10mg is a widely prescribed oral anti-diabetic medication used to manage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us. Belonging to the second-generation sulfonylurea class, Glipizide works by stimulating the pancreas to release insulin, thereby reducing blood sugar levels.

Globally, the prevalence of Type 2 Diabetes has been rising rapidly, with the World Health Organization (WHO) estimating that over 422 million people are currently living with diabetes.
